Jolynn2262 Posted July 5, 2008 #1 Share Posted July 5, 2008 My Baltics cruise leaves in 4 days and I signed on to Princess this morning just to look things over. They listed all the forms I need to have with me and I have already printed out my boarding pass and travel summary. My question now comes from the fact that it states to print out the Personal Imigration Form to bring as well. I did this online ages ago and it has stated as such on my cruise personalizer. The form itself actually states it must be received at least 14 days out. Do I really need to print it and fill it out to have with me at check in? Pam in CA Posted July 5, 2008 #7 Share Posted July 5, 2008 You don't have to print out your PIF but what the heck, it's only one piece of paper. You can pre-sign it before checking in and it'll save a few minutes. I always print out and bring mine if only because there's a certain security in knowing that I have it with me and I can prove that I filled out everything. :) FYI, last year when I was embarking on the Golden Princess in Buenos Aires, the lines were incredible, the area around the terminal building absolutely packed. Those with boarding passes already printed out and could be produced were allowed to go in first. I'm sure this doesn't happen often but it saved me about an hour and a half in line.
